面向智能家居的WSN网络路由能量优化算法研究  被引量:3

Research on Routing Energy Optimization Algorithm for WSN Network Used in Smart Home

摘  要:针对WSN在智能家居的应用特点,ZigBee网络点节能量受限于电池能量,网络中的信息传递完整性与网络生命周期依赖各个节点的能量状况。在ZigBee路由协议的基础上,通过结合AODVjr和Cluster-Tree协议的优点,引入基于泰森图的动态分簇算法,运用几何关系分簇,有效减少了在节点加入簇的过程中,节点间通信所耗费的大量能量,有效地解决当前ZigBee网络中存在的高能量消耗以及低移动鲁棒性问题,延长了网络的使用寿命,降低了整个网络的能量消耗。In the application of WSN in smart home,there are some problems such as the energy of ZigBee network node is limited by the battery energy,the integrity of information transmission in the network and the life cycle of the network depends on the energy status of each node.To solve these problems,on the basis of ZigBee routing protocol,a dynamic clustering algorithm based on Voronoi diagram is introduced by combining the advantages of AODVjr and Cluster-Tree protocols.The use of geometric relations for clustering effectively reduces the communication energy consumption between nodes in the node to join the cluster.It effectively solves the problems of high energy consumption and low mobile robustness in the ZigBee network,prolongs the service life of the network,and reduces the energy consumption of the entire network.

关 键 词:无线传感网络 ZigBee 泰森图 路由协议 动态分簇
